Warangal Fort, a testament to the city's rich history, stands as one of the premier historical sites in Warangal. Built during the Kakatiya dynasty, the fort's sprawling ruins narrate tales of a bygone era, showcasing intricate carvings and architectural brilliance. Visitors can delve into the past, imagining the grandeur of this once-majestic stronghold, making it a must-visit among Warangal tourist attractions.

Warangal's artistic allure extends to the Kakatiya Rock Garden, a unique creation where nature meets art. Sculptures crafted from rocks and stones create an outdoor gallery, offering a refreshing blend of creativity and natural beauty. It's an offbeat experience that showcases the city's commitment to preserving its cultural identity in innovative ways.
For outdoor activities in Warangal, Pakhal Lake emerges as a tranquil escape. Surrounded by hills and greenery, the lake provides a picturesque setting for boating. Whether indulging in a peaceful boat ride or capturing the beauty of the surroundings, visitors can relish the serenity of Pakhal Lake, making it an ideal spot for leisure and outdoor enthusiasts.

A pinnacle of architectural marvel, the Thousand Pillar Temple is a highlight among Warangal tourist attractions. Adorned with intricately carved pillars, this historical site offers a captivating journey into the Kakatiya dynasty's architectural prowess. Exploring the temple complex is like unravelling the pages of Warangal's glorious past.

Nature enthusiasts can immerse themselves in wild adventures at the Eturnagaram Wildlife Sanctuary. This sanctuary, among the outdoor activities in Warangal, preserves diverse flora and fauna. A safari through its lush landscapes provides a unique opportunity to witness indigenous wildlife, contributing to the city's efforts in conservation.
